School Ratings in Selston Green
There are 110 schools in and around Selston Green. John King Infant Academy and Longwood Infant Academy are each rated Outstanding by Ofsted. A further 22 schools hold a Good rating.
House Prices in Selston Green
The average property price is £222K, with detached homes making up the majority of the housing stock at around £270K.

Household Income in Selston Green ONS 2023
The average total household income in Selston Green is approximately £45,875 a year before tax, 17% below the national average of £55,302. After tax and benefits, the average disposable (net) household income is around £35,287. These are modelled estimates from the Office for National Statistics for the financial year ending 2023.

Businesses in Selston Green ONS 2025
There are approximately 1,969 active businesses based in Selston Green, around 31 for every 1,000 residents. The local economy is dominated by small firms: about 89% are micro-businesses employing fewer than 10 people, while 38 are larger employers with 50 or more staff. Figures are from the Office for National Statistics UK Business Counts.

Home Ownership in Selston Green
Of the 28,344 households in and around Selston Green, 74% are owned, 12% are socially rented and 14% are privately rented. Home ownership here is higher than the England and Wales average of 63%.
Tenure from the 2021 Census (ONS), for the postcode districts covering Selston Green.
